Abstract

A method for routing data packets (DP) to a mobile node (MN) from its correspondent node (CN), via a multi-bearer network, or MBN. The MBN comprises uplink bearer networks (GSM, GPRS, UMTS) and downlink bearer networks (DxB). The method comprises: 1) storing an address (202) associated with a centralized traffic policy controller (TPC) as the mobile node's care-of address in its home agent (HA); 2) routing an initial data packet via the home agent and the centralized traffic policy controller to a bearer network interface unit (DxB_IU, DL_IU) serving the mobile node; 3) storing an address (214) of the bearer network interface unit as the mobile node's care-of address in the correspondent node (CN); 4) routing subsequent data packets from the correspondent node (CN) to the bearer network interface unit (DxB_IU, DL_IU), whereby the home agent (HA) and the centralized traffic policy controller are bypassed.
